Research funding for Alzheimer's researchers in Jülich

Scientists from the Forschungszentrum Jülich research centre and the Heinrich Heine University Düsseldorf work on developing new methods for the early diagnosis of Alzheimer's disease. To this end, they have now been granted funding by the German Federal Ministry of Research totalling 64,400 Euro. The research projects receiving the funding are part of the international "BiomarkAPD" project, a network of over 70 research groups from more than 20 countries.
